Key Ingredients and Their Benefits




Adivasi hair oil is composed of several potent herbs and natural extracts known for their favorable impacts on hair health and wellness:

Bhringraj: Often referred to as the "king of herbs" for hair, Bhringraj is believed to promote hair growth, strengthen hair follicles, and protect against premature graying.

Brahmi: This herb is recognized to nourish the scalp, strengthen blood vessels, and improve blood flow, which can result in reduced hair fall and enhanced hair growth.

Amla (Indian Gooseberry): Rich in vitamin C and antioxidants, Amla strengthens hair roots, protects against dandruff, and adds appeal to the hair.

Coconut Oil: Known for its deep conditioning properties, coconut oil penetrates the hair shaft, reducing protein loss and providing moisture to dry hair.

Aloe Vera: With its soothing and moisturizing properties, Aloe Vera helps maintain the pH balance of the scalp, reduces dandruff, and promotes healthy and balanced hair growth.

Kapoor (Camphor): Camphor has antimicrobial properties that can help in treating scalp infections and reducing itchiness, promoting a healthier scalp atmosphere.

How to Use Adivasi Hair Oil

To make the most of the benefits of Adivasi hair oil, comply with these actions:

Application: Take a percentage of oil in your hand and warm it by scrubing your hands together. Carefully massage it into your scalp using circular movements, making sure even distribution.

Massage: Continue massaging for 5-10 minutes to enhance blood flow to the hair roots.

Saturating Period: Leave the oil on for at the very least 2 hours, or ideally overnight, to allow deep infiltration into the scalp and hair shafts.

Laundering: Wash your hair with a moderate, sulfate-free shampoo to remove the oil. You might require to shampoo twice to ensure all deposit is gotten rid of.

Frequency: For optimum outcomes, use the oil 2-3 times a week constantly.
